Hanteringsslutpunkter
Dessa slutpunkter låter dig hantera API-nycklar, formulärregler, varningsregler och andra inställningar programmatiskt. Alla hanteringsslutpunkter kräver JWT-autentisering.
Base URL: https://api.silentshield.io
API-nycklar
| Method | Path | Description |
|---|---|---|
GET | /api/v1/keys | Lista alla API-nycklar för ditt konto. |
POST | /api/v1/keys | Skapa en ny API-nyckel. |
GET | /api/v1/keys/:id | Hämta detaljer för en specifik API-nyckel. |
PUT | /api/v1/keys/:id | Uppdatera en API-nyckels inställningar. |
DELETE | /api/v1/keys/:id | Ta bort en API-nyckel. Denna åtgärd är oåterkallelig. |
POST | /api/v1/keys/:id/rotate | Rotera en API-nyckel. Den gamla nyckeln ogiltigförklaras omedelbart. |
Formulärregler
| Method | Path | Description |
|---|---|---|
GET | /api/v1/keys/:keyId/form-rules | Lista alla formulärregler för en API-nyckel. |
POST | /api/v1/keys/:keyId/form-rules | Skapa en ny formulärregel. |
PUT | /api/v1/keys/:keyId/form-rules/:id | Uppdatera en formulärregel. |
DELETE | /api/v1/keys/:keyId/form-rules/:id | Ta bort en formulärregel. |
Varningsregler
| Method | Path | Description |
|---|---|---|
GET | /api/v1/keys/:keyId/alert-rules | Lista alla varningsregler för en API-nyckel. |
POST | /api/v1/keys/:keyId/alert-rules | Skapa en ny varningsregel. |
PUT | /api/v1/keys/:keyId/alert-rules/:id | Uppdatera en varningsregel. |
DELETE | /api/v1/keys/:keyId/alert-rules/:id | Ta bort en varningsregel. |